Tried rush bowls for the first time and had a great experience! The owners are lovely and accommodating to your preferences/dietary restrictions. He took the time to describe the menu and mentioned some favorites. We tried the PB&J bowl (swapped out PB for almond butter). Delicious!! Love that they stand on no added sugar. They even have gluten-free granola! We also tried the tropic bliss smoothie, which tasted fresh! Thank you!!

I frequent this establishment often. While I have only had their smoothie bowls, I have not been disappointed. Each bowl has its own unique taste and I like the fact that there are so many fresh toppings. This place was a treat when I was eating raw foods for a period of time. You can sub many of the ingredients as well. If you want a light snack or meal replacement, I highly recommend. Customer service is also great as well! The price is more expensive than chain smoothie places BUT I believe that also is because they aren’t using a lot of artificial sweetener, whey, and other fillers that big chains use. Worth the price in my opinion.
